RECENT ISSUE OF PATENTSMosher Curtis of Troy reportthe recent issue of patents in thisvicinity as follows: To A. G. Betts,Troy, for treating arsenical ores andspiess; to W. J. Bradley, Troy, for a4boiler flue cleaner; to F. W. Bran-dow, assignor to Jacobson- BrandowCo., Pittsfield, Mass., for a spark indicator; to B. S. Ells, Troy, for acollar; to F. E. Fellion, Malone, fora cuspidor; to W. D. Lockwood, Schenectady, for a concrete bucket;also the following by assignments toGeneral Electric Co., Schenectady:From E. F. W. Alexanderson, inventor, Schenectady, for a single phasemotor control; also for an alterhat-ing current motor; from A. G. Davis, inventor, Schenectady,A. G. Davis, inventor, Schenectady,for a block signal system; from J.T. H. Dempster, inventor, Schnec-tady, for making alloys; from L. A. Hawkins, inventor, Schenectady, fora rotary converter for direct currents; from G. H. Mill, inventor,*Schenectady, for a control apparatus;from J. A.
